BAB 1 PENDAHULUAN 1.1 Latar Belakang Dengan meningkatnya pendapatan, aspirasi, dan kesejahteraan warga mengakibatkan meningkatnya konsumsi jasa dalam bentuk komoditas wisata dan bagi sebagian masyarakat telah menjadi suatu bagian dari kebutuhannya. Pada masa-masa liburan, banyak di antara warga yang mengisinya dengan berwisata ke suatu daerah yang menjadi tujuannya. Kabupaten Deli Serdang adalah salah satu destinasi wisata yang menarik untuk dikunjungi. Banyak wisatawan lokal maupun mancanegara untuk menikmati keindahan alam Deli Serdang. Untuk memudahkan para warga yang ingin berwisata, dibutuhkan suatu pelayanan informasi yang serba cepat, efisien dan efektif mengenai tujuan wisata beserta objek-objek yang menarik yang ada serta sarana penginapan dan transportasi yang bisa digunakan sebagai kebutuhan liburan. Di samping kebutuhan para wisatawan terhadap informasi yang akurat dan lengkap, terdapat pula pihak-pihak lainnya yang membutuhkan data beserta informasi terkait, di antaranya yaitu pengelolaan industri kepariwisataan dan pemerintahan karena memiliki peran dalam mengambil keputusan dan sebagai penentu kebijakan di bidang kepariwisataan. Kebutuhan akan informasi ini berbeda di setiap pihak sesuai dengan kebutuhan. Bagi para wisatawan, kemudahan dalam pengaksesan sistem informasi yang baik akan membantunya dalam merencanakan perjalanan wisatanya. Transaksi yang dilakukan berupa konvensional maupun online
2 diberikan mudah dan aman akan menjadi tolak ukur kepuasan para wisatawan dalam melakukan kunjungannya. Sebagai pihak pengelola industri pariwisata beserta pihak pemerintah, dengan keberadaan Sistem Informasi Pariwisata Deli Serdang yang baik akan sangat membantu guna pengambilan keputusan. Dengan adanya Sistem Informasi yang terintegrasi serta dengan adanya dukungan sistem komputerisasi seperti website, manajemen data pariwisata akan lebih mencapai sasarannya. Atas dasar itulah, penulis memilih judul Perancangan Aplikasi Sistem Informasi Pariwisata Kabupaten Deli Serdang Berbasis Web. 1.2 Rumusan Masalah Berdasarkan uraian latar belakang masalah yang telah diuraikan di atas, maka dapat dituliskan rumusan masalah adalah membangun sistem yang mengolah data pariwisata untuk menginformasikan daerah pariwisata, sarana dan prasarana liburan yang sedang berjalan di Kabupaten Deli Serdang dan bagaimana merancang aplikasi sistem informasi berbasis web. 1.3 Batasan Masalah Agar masalah yang dibahas tidak menyimpang dari tujuan, maka perlu dibuat suatu batasan masalah, yaitu: Perancangan sistem informasi pariwisata hanya untuk menampilkan informasi wisata, hotel dan rute perjalanan Kabupaten Deli Serdang, sistem informasi pariwisata dirancang dengan menggunakan PHP dan server database yang digunakan MySQL. Perancangan sistem informasi pariwisata tidak membahas tentang keamanan yang rentan cyber crime oleh hacker maupun cracker.
3 1.4 Tujuan Tujuan penelitian dilakukan adalah: 1. Membangun suatu website yang dinamis yang dimanfaatkan untuk menyebarkan informasi yang baik dengan cepat dan mudah. 2. Mempromosikan wisata Kabupaten Deli Serdang Provinsi Sumatera Utara. 3. Terbentuknya suatu media informasi pariwisata yang berbasis website pada Kabupaten Deli Serdang. 4. Mampu membuka wawasan para pengguna internet untuk dapat memanfaatkan sumber daya komputer yang ada. 5. Sistem informasi pariwisata diharapakan dapat menambah pengunjung sehingga memberikan dampak positif bagi perekonomian daerah. 1.5 Tinjauan Pustaka Salah satu teknologi baru yang mulai banyak dimanfaatkan untuk perkembangan web adalah PHP. PHP atau Hypertext Preprocessor adalah bahasa yang bersifat server side yang memiliki kemampuan untuk dikombinasikan dengan teks, HTML, dan komponen-komponen lain untuk membuat suatu halaman web lebih menarik, dinamis dan interaktif. PHP dimaksudkan untuk menggantikan teknologi lama seperti CGI (Common Gateway Interface) yang juga bahasa pengembangan web. Dengan pengembang halaman web menjadi mudah dan lebih cepat bekerja (Panduan Lengkap Menguasai Pemrograman Web dengan PHP 5, Wahana Komputer. 2006). PHP adalah bahasa pemrograman yang berjalan pada sebuah web server, atau sering disebut server-side. PHP dapat melakukan apa saja yang dapat
4 dilakukan oleh program lain, yaitu mengolah data dengan tipe apapun, menciptakan halaman web yang dinamis, serta menerima dan menciptakan data cookies. Namun PHP mempunyai kemampuan lebih dari itu. PHP dapat berjalan pada semua jenis sistem operasi, antara lain Linux, Unix, Microsoft Windows, Mac OS, dan masih banyak lagi. Selain itu PHP juga dapat berjalan pada beberapa jenis web server antara lain Apache, Netscape, Xitami, Microsoft Internet Information services, dan sebagainya (Panduan dan Referensi Kamus Fungsi PHP 5, H. Rafiza. 2006). PHP, sebagai bahasa pemrograman berbasis web, mempunyai lebih banyak kelebihan dibanding bahasa sejenis lainnya. Selain gratis, PHP juga mempunyai fungsi-fungsi yang cukup lengkap, multiplatform serta mampu berinteraksi dengan berbagai macam database. Pada PHP, banyak komponen atau fungsi yang dapat digunakan untuk berbagai macam kebutuhan. Tidak hanya FTP, fungsi mengakses e-mail dapat pula digunakan dengan gratis. Keunggulan PHP yang lain adalah dukungan terhadap berbagai jenis web server. Hampir semua web server didukung oleh PHP, tetapi yang paling umum ialah penggabungan PHP dengan Apache, web server gratis (Panduan Membuat Aplikasi Database dengan PHP 5, M.Syafii. 2005). Untuk membangun sebuah web page dibutuhkan sebuah bahasa pemrograman yang lebih dikenal dengan sebutan web scripting. Web scripting yang bersifat client side akan menghasilkan web page yang statis, artinya lebih menekankan pada desain format tampilan informasi. HTML (Hypertext Markup Languange) adalah bahasa untuk web scripting bersifat dclient side yang
5 memungkinkan untuk menampilkan informasi dalam bentuk teks, grafik, serta multimedia dan juga untuk menghubungkan antar tampilan web page (hyperlink). 1.6 Metode Penelitian Untuk menyusun tugas akhir ini, penulis melakukan metode penelitian adalah sebagai berikut: 1. Studi Kepustakaan Studi Kepustakaan ini di maksudkan untuk mendapatkan landasan teori yang memadai dalam menyusun tugas akhir. 2. Melakukan Observasi Penulis melakukan observasi secara langsung pada Dinas Kebudayaan dan Pariwisata Kabupaten Deli Serdang untuk mengetahui informasi pariwisata yang dibutuhkan oleh wisatawan. 3. Merancang Database Dalam membuat database, penulis menggunakan software sistem manajemen database MySQL dan server lokal Xampp sebagai tempat penyimpanan data yang fleksibel dan dinamis. 4. Merancang Desain Web Pada tahap ini, penulis mendesain tampilan halaman web dengan menggunakan perangkat lunak (software) seperti Macromedia Dreamweaver. 5. Merancang Program Pada tahap ini, penulis merancang program menggunakan bahasa PHP serta membuat listing program dari setiap menu-menu halaman web yang akan di tampilkan.
6 6. Penguji Program Pada tahap ini, penulis menguji program untuk mengetahui kesalahankesalahan dalam program dan memperbaiki kembali program tersebut sehingga pada tahap selanjutnya program dapat berjalan dengan sempurna. 7. Membuat Kesimpulan Setelah menyelesaikan tahap-tahap di atas maka penulis dapat mengambil keputusan mengenai sistem yang telah dirancang.